Review
BACKGROUND
Preliminary data suggest that patients with COVID-19 may experience psychiatric symptoms, including psychosis. We systematically reviewed the literature to evaluate the concurrence of new-onset psychosis or exacerbation of clinically stable psychosis through case reports and case series.
METHODS
Six databases were searched, followed by an electronic and manual search of the relevant articles. Studies were identified using predetermined eligibility criteria. We evaluated the demographic characteristics, clinical history, course of illness, management, and prognosis of the patients in these studies.
RESULTS
Case reports and case series, altogether consisting of 57 unique cases were included. The mean patient age for onset of psychotic symptoms was 43.4 years for men and 40.3 years for women. About 69% of patients had no prior history of psychiatric disorders. Most patients had mild COVID-19-related symptoms, with only 15 (26.3%) presenting with moderate to severe COVID-19-related disease and complications. The most commonly reported psychotic symptoms were delusions and hallucinations. Patients with psychotic symptoms were treated with antipsychotics, benzodiazepines, valproic acid, and electroconvulsive treatment. In 36 cases, psychotic symptoms resolved completely or improved significantly. Ten cases had partial improvement with residual psychotic symptoms, and one patient died due to cardiac arrest.
CONCLUSION
Most patients responded to a low-to-moderate dose of antipsychotics with a quick recovery. However, the residual psychiatric symptoms highlight the need for careful monitoring and longer follow-up. Clinicians should be mindful of the occurrence of psychosis due to COVID-19 infection in a subset of COVID-19 patients that can be misdiagnosed as a psychotic disorder alone.

Review
Traditional teaching suggests that corticosteroids should be avoided during acute infectious episodes for fear of compromising the immune response. However, the outcome benefit shown through steroid administration in early septic shock implies this paranoia may be misplaced. We therefore performed a systematic review of the literature to identify the current strength of evidence for the use of corticosteroids in specified infections, and to make appropriate graded recommendations.

Meta-Analysis
OBJECTIVES
Clozapine (CLZ) is prescribed to (relatively) treatment-resistant patients with schizophrenia spectrum disorders. Currently, it is unknown what factors predict response to CLZ. Therefore, we performed meta-analyses to identify predictors of CLZ response, hence aiming to facilitate timely and efficient prescribing of CLZ.
METHODS
A systematic search was performed in 'Pubmed' and 'Embase' until 1 January 2019. Articles were eligible if they provided data on predictors of CLZ response measured demographic and clinical factors at baseline or biochemical factors at follow-up in schizophrenia spectrum disorder patients.
RESULTS
A total of 34 articles, total number of participants = 9386; N unique = 2094, were eligible. Factors significantly associated with better CLZ response were: lower age, lower PANSS negative score and paranoid schizophrenia subtype.
CONCLUSION
The results of our meta-analyses suggest that three baseline demographic and clinical features are associated with better clozapine response, i.e. relatively young age, few negative symptoms and paranoid schizophrenia subtype. These variables may be taken into account by clinicians who consider treating a specific patient with CLZ.

BACKGROUND
Cannabis has been documented for use in alleviating anxiety. However, certain research has also shown that it can produce feelings of anxiety, panic, paranoia and psychosis. In humans, Δ-tetrahydrocannabinol (THC) has been associated with an anxiogenic response, while anxiolytic activity has been attributed mainly to cannabidiol (CBD). In animal studies, the effects of THC are highly dose-dependent, and biphasic effects of cannabinoids on anxiety-related responses have been extensively documented. A more precise assessment is required of both the anxiolytic and anxiogenic potentials of phytocannabinoids, with an aim towards the development of the 'holy grail' in cannabis research, a medicinally-active formulation which may assist in the treatment of anxiety or mood disorders without eliciting any anxiogenic effects.
OBJECTIVES
To systematically review studies assessing cannabinoid interventions (e.g. THC or CBD or whole cannabis interventions) both in animals and humans, as well as recent epidemiological studies reporting on anxiolytic or anxiogenic effects from cannabis consumption.
METHOD
The articles selected for this review were identified up to January 2020 through searches in the electronic databases OVID MEDLINE, Cochrane Central Register of Controlled Trials, PubMed, and PsycINFO.
RESULTS
Acute doses of CBD were found to reduce anxiety both in animals and humans, without having an anxiogenic effect at higher doses. Epidemiological studies tend to support an anxiolytic effect from the consumption of either CBD or THC, as well as whole plant cannabis. Conversely, the available human clinical studies demonstrate a common anxiogenic response to THC (especially at higher doses).
CONCLUSION
Based on current data, cannabinoid therapies (containing primarily CBD) may provide a more suitable treatment for people with pre-existing anxiety or as a potential adjunctive role in managing anxiety or stress-related disorders. However, further research is needed to explore other cannabinoids and phytochemical constituents present in cannabis (e.g. terpenes) as anxiolytic interventions. Future clinical trials involving patients with anxiety disorders are warranted due to the small number of available human studies.

BACKGROUND
How cannabis products are being used by cancer patients and survivors in the United States is poorly understood. This study reviewed observational data to understand the modes, patterns, reasons, discontinuation, and adverse experiences of cannabis use.
METHODS
PubMed and PsycINFO database searches were conducted between May 2022 and November 2022. Of the 1162 studies identified, 27 studies met the inclusion criteria. The intercoder agreement was strong (0.81).
RESULTS
The majority (74%) of the studies were cross-sectional in design. Study samples were approximately equal proportions of men and women and majority White participants. The prevalence of cannabis use based on national samples ranged between 4.8% and 22%. The most common modes of cannabis intake were topical application (80%), smoking (73%), vaping (12%), and ingestion of edible products (10%). Younger age, male gender, being a current or former smoker, and higher socioeconomic status were associated with greater likelihood of cannabis use. The main motive for cannabis use was management of symptoms due to cancer or cancer treatment such as pain, nausea, lack of sleep, and anxiety. A majority of the participants across studies reported that cannabis helped reduce these symptoms. Lack of symptom improvement, side effects such as fatigue and paranoia, cost, and social stigma were identified as some of the reasons for discontinuing cannabis use.
CONCLUSIONS
It appears that cannabis may help cancer patients and survivors manage symptoms. However, more longitudinal studies are needed to determine whether positive experiences of cannabis use outweigh adverse experiences over time in this vulnerable population.
